Access temperature sensor, TYPE_TEMPERATURE and TYPE_AMBIENT_TEMPERATURE.

The temperature sensors (Sensor.TYPE_TEMPERATURE/Sensor.TYPE_AMBIENT_TEMPERATURE) are used to determine temperature of the phone, for internal hardware. They are not available on all device. (It's not available on my HTC One X and HTC Flyer!)

Sensor.TYPE_TEMPERATURE is deprecated, use Sensor.TYPE_AMBIENT_TEMPERATURE instead.

Example:
package com.example.androidsensor;

import android.hardware.Sensor;
import android.hardware.SensorEvent;
import android.hardware.SensorEventListener;
import android.hardware.SensorManager;
import android.os.Bundle;
import android.app.Activity;
import android.widget.TextView;

public class MainActivity extends Activity {

TextView textTEMPERATURE_available, textTEMPERATURE_reading;
TextView textAMBIENT_TEMPERATURE_available, textAMBIENT_TEMPERATURE_reading;

@Override
public void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_main);

textTEMPERATURE_available
= (TextView)findViewById(R.id.TEMPERATURE_available);
textTEMPERATURE_reading
= (TextView)findViewById(R.id.TEMPERATURE_reading);
textAMBIENT_TEMPERATURE_available
= (TextView)findViewById(R.id.AMBIENT_TEMPERATURE_available);
textAMBIENT_TEMPERATURE_reading
= (TextView)findViewById(R.id.AMBIENT_TEMPERATURE_reading);

SensorManager mySensorManager = (SensorManager)getSystemService(SENSOR_SERVICE);

Sensor TemperatureSensor = mySensorManager.getDefaultSensor(Sensor.TYPE_TEMPERATURE);
if(TemperatureSensor != null){
textTEMPERATURE_available.setText("Sensor.TYPE_TEMPERATURE Available");
mySensorManager.registerListener(
TemperatureSensorListener,
TemperatureSensor,
SensorManager.SENSOR_DELAY_NORMAL);

}else{
textTEMPERATURE_available.setText("Sensor.TYPE_TEMPERATURE NOT Available");
}

Sensor AmbientTemperatureSensor
= mySensorManager.getDefaultSensor(Sensor.TYPE_AMBIENT_TEMPERATURE);
if(AmbientTemperatureSensor != null){
textAMBIENT_TEMPERATURE_available.setText("Sensor.TYPE_AMBIENT_TEMPERATURE Available");
mySensorManager.registerListener(
AmbientTemperatureSensorListener,
AmbientTemperatureSensor,
SensorManager.SENSOR_DELAY_NORMAL);
}else{
textAMBIENT_TEMPERATURE_available.setText("Sensor.TYPE_AMBIENT_TEMPERATURE NOT Available");
}
}

private final SensorEventListener TemperatureSensorListener
= new SensorEventListener(){

@Override
public void onAccuracyChanged(Sensor sensor, int accuracy) {
// TODO Auto-generated method stub

}

@Override
public void onSensorChanged(SensorEvent event) {
if(event.sensor.getType() == Sensor.TYPE_TEMPERATURE){
textTEMPERATURE_reading.setText("TEMPERATURE: " + event.values[0]);
}
}

};

private final SensorEventListener AmbientTemperatureSensorListener
= new SensorEventListener(){

@Override
public void onAccuracyChanged(Sensor sensor, int accuracy) {
// TODO Auto-generated method stub

}

@Override
public void onSensorChanged(SensorEvent event) {
if(event.sensor.getType() == Sensor.TYPE_AMBIENT_TEMPERATURE){
textAMBIENT_TEMPERATURE_reading.setText("AMBIENT TEMPERATURE: " + event.values[0]);
}
}

};

}


<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
xmlns:tools="http://schemas.android.com/tools"
android:layout_width="match_parent"
android:layout_height="match_parent"
android:orientation="vertical">

<TextView
android:layout_width="wrap_content"
android:layout_height="wrap_content"
android:text="@string/hello_world"
tools:context=".MainActivity" />

<TextView
android:id="@+id/TEMPERATURE_available"
android:layout_width="fill_parent"
android:layout_height="wrap_content" />
<TextView
android:id="@+id/TEMPERATURE_reading"
android:layout_width="fill_parent"
android:layout_height="wrap_content" />
<TextView
android:id="@+id/AMBIENT_TEMPERATURE_available"
android:layout_width="fill_parent"
android:layout_height="wrap_content" />
<TextView
android:id="@+id/AMBIENT_TEMPERATURE_reading"
android:layout_width="fill_parent"
android:layout_height="wrap_content" />

</LinearLayout>

Read Aperture, Exposure Time, and ISO from Exif

The post "Read EXIF of JPG file" demonstrate how to read Exif from JPG file using ExifInterface. Start from API Level 11, Exif tag of TAG_APERTURE, TAG_EXPOSURE_TIME and TAG_ISO was added in the android.media.ExifInterface class. You can simple modify the code in "Read EXIF of JPG file" to read Aperture, Exposure Time, and ISO from Exif.
